ZERO STAGE S14 Progress - custom comp entry

Huh?... Zero Stage S14??... What the funk is that???... Well its a Nissan Silvia S14 with S15 front end, RB26DETT supplying the grunt and its...err...blue Appeared in Option/2 a few times from which i'm getting all my reference. I'd tell you all alot more about it if I could read Japanese but i'm not bothered about specs - i just think it looks cool and presented the perfect opportunity to work on a S14 kit...


Taking one Fujimi S14 and one S15, I began with a little cut and shut - just like they do down at Honest Joe's Quality Used Cars just down the road from me Taking inspiration and reference from spoolin's excellent 180sx/S15 project thread, I opted for a similar cutting point for the two front ends. I measured up many times being extra careful to get the cuts right, surprisingly the process was trouble free and with first dry fitting the S15 front mated up quite nicely to the S14.



Some slight modification was required before the S15 was grafted on though. To begin with the S15 front being narrower and with diferent contours meant there was little surafce area between it and the S14 body to provide a good enough bond. To remedy this a strip of .030 styrene was glued to the inside of the S14 body along the edge of the cut. Prior to this .010 styrene was glued to the face of the cut to replace the plastic removed by the razor saw.



Strips of styrene were also placed infront of the widscreen to fill the gap between it and the S15 hood. The profile was carefully sanded to shape



With the S15 front now firmly attached, the shapes of styrene you can see behind the front wheel arches were placed there to make up the difference in width. Filler was not used for this as I shall need to build upon this area with more styrene later on so a good bond is needed. Other styrene strips of various thickness were glued at strategic places on the rear for the wide body kit. Thin .010 pieces were used to define the outline of the bolt on wider fenders and thus obtain a crisp edge. The contour of the fender will be aided by the pieces across the length of the rear and round the wheel arch, this should become clear later on.






I shall be doing similar work on the front in preparation for putty work later on which will be shown in future updates. It makes a change to do this sort of build instead of modifications necessary for t/kits, hopefully I can get i finished in time for comp.
